Nonlocal effective action and particle creation in $D$ dimensions

hep-th · 2024-12-04 · accept · novelty 6.0

The vacuum-persistence probability for a quantum field in a weak gravitational background is computed to second order in curvatures in D dimensions; conformal fields in conformally flat spacetimes do not create particles at this order.
